The Mouse BALP (Bone Alkaline Phosphatase) CLIA Kit is designed for the accurate and precise measurement of BALP levels in mouse serum, plasma, and cell culture supernatants. This kit boasts high sensitivity and specificity, ensuring dependable and consistent results for various research applications.BALP is a key enzyme found in bone tissue that plays a critical role in bone mineralization and turnover. Monitoring BALP levels can provide valuable insights into bone health and metabolism, making it a valuable biomarker for studying bone-related disorders and evaluating potential treatments.Overall, the Mouse BALP CLIA Kit is a valuable tool for researchers seeking to analyze bone alkaline phosphatase levels in mouse models, providing essential data for further understanding bone physiology and pathology.

This kit uses a sandwich chemiluminescence immunoassay (CLIA) principle. The microplate is pre-coated with an antibody specific to the target protein. Standards or samples are added to the wells and bind to the immobilized antibody. A biotinylated detection antibody is then added, followed by HRP-conjugated streptavidin to form a sandwich complex. After washing to remove unbound components, a chemiluminescent substrate is added. The HRP enzyme catalyzes a light-emitting reaction. The intensity of the emitted light is directly proportional to the concentration of the target protein in the sample. The signal is measured using a luminometer, and the concentration of the analyte is calculated based on a standard curve.
